Farsoon introduces large-format metal PBF system
Summary
Farsoon has introduced the FS1311M-U, a large-format metal powder bed fusion system featuring 16 lasers capable of build rates up to 1440 cm³/h when processing Ti-6Al-4V at 150 µm layer thickness. The system targets high-throughput metal additive manufacturing applications where build volume and deposition rate have historically constrained production viability. This positions Farsoon as a direct competitor in the industrial-scale metal AM segment currently dominated by EOS, SLM Solutions, and Trumpf.
Why It Matters
A build rate of 1440 cm³/h in Ti-6Al-4V is a meaningful threshold — it begins to close the cost-per-part gap that has kept metal PBF largely confined to low-volume, high-value aerospace and medical components. For manufacturers evaluating additive as a legitimate production pathway rather than a prototyping tool, 16-laser architecture means reduced cycle time per build and better amortization of machine capital against part output. The practical implication for operations teams is that batch sizes previously requiring multiple machine shifts or parallel systems may consolidate onto a single platform, which simplifies scheduling and reduces inert gas consumption per unit. Supply chain teams sourcing titanium aerospace brackets or structural components should monitor qualification timelines for this platform, as broader OEM adoption could shift make-versus-buy calculus for near-net-shape titanium work within the next 18 to 36 months.
